Hello @Kjoy5604 

Open your Fitbit App, tap your profile picture, scroll down and tap the name of your Fitbit tracker then tap gallery. Now scroll down and tap weather. Next tap settings. Change the weather to your desired reading under temperature unit. Go back to the Fitbit App today page and sync your Fitbit tracker.

Hello again @Kjoy5604 

For weather showing directly on the clock face there may or may not be a clock face setting to change.

If it is still a problem using the same path as described in previous post

  • remove cities in the weather list of cities setting
  • and use current location
  • and sync again.

If the above doesn't do the trick, I'd recommend to try switching to a clock face that actually shows both units of measurements, Celsius and Fahrenheit, as not all clock faces will show the temperature in Celsius or Fahrenheit even when you've set it to be that way.
